Candidate Responsibilities:

The Cloud security engineer is responsible for facilitating security
efforts and remediating security vulnerabilities partnering with app teams
to identify gaps and remediate security issues. Security Engineers will
help develop policies and assist development teams in implementing
solutions to close those security gaps and make services compliant to
enterprise security requirements.
